Mali (/ ˈ m ɑː l i / (); French pronunciation: ), officially the Republic of Mali (French: République du Mali), is a landlocked country in West Africa, a region geologically identified with the West African Craton.Mali is the eighth-largest country in Africa, with an area of just over 1,240,000 square kilometres (480,000 sq mi).The population of Mali is 18 million.
